ADO.NET Entity Framework na InfoQ
Notícias sobre ADO.NET Entity Framework
- Tópicos
- .NET Framework 4.0,
- ADO.NET Entity Framework,
- ADO.NET,
- Framework .NET,
- .NET,
- Persistência,
- Acesso a Dados,
- Bancos de dados,
- Programação,
- nHibernate,
- LINQ to SQL
O LLBLGen Pro é uma ferramenta ORM que suporta múltiplos frameworks de mapeamento: LLBLGen Pro Runtime, Entity Framework, NHibernate e LINQ to SQL. Outras novas funcionalidades são: suporte ao .NET 4.0, model-first ou database-first development mode, model view e project validation.
- Tópicos
- ADO.NET Entity Framework,
- ADO.NET,
- .NET,
- Acesso a Dados,
- Programação,
- nHibernate,
- LINQ to SQL,
- Bancos de dados,
- ORM,
- Desempenho e Escalabilidade
Infelizmente, os termos "ORM" e "problemas de performance" freqüentemente caminham juntos. Ao ocultar o SQL dos desenvolvedores, ORMs pode oferecer um aumento de produtividade enorme. Infelizmente, eles tornam mais fácil gerar consultas ridiculamente ruins, sem percebermos.
- Tópicos
- ADO.NET Entity Framework,
- ADO.NET,
- .NET,
- Acesso a Dados,
- Oracle,
- Bancos de dados,
- Programação,
- ORM
A visão da Microsoft do .NET é abrangente. Além do desejo de suportar todas as linguagens de programação, seja diretamente, seja através de camadas de interoperabilidade, ela também quer juntar todos os frameworks de comunicação e engines de armazenamento de dados.
- Tópicos
- ADO.NET Entity Framework,
- ADO.NET Data Services,
- Framework .NET,
- ADO.NET,
- .NET Services,
- Plataforma SOA,
- .NET,
- AJAX,
- Acesso a Dados,
- SOA,
- Programação,
- Arquitetura Corporativa,
- Arquitetura,
- Bancos de dados,
- RIA
Ontem, a Microsoft lançou o .Net RIA Services, que costumava ser chamada projeto “Alexandria”., wAté agora ele era segredo. Nesta apresentação da MIX 09, Nikhil Kithari, um Arquiteto de Software da Microsoft, comentou:
- Tópicos
- ADO.NET Entity Framework,
- ADO.NET,
- .NET,
- Acesso a Dados,
- IBM,
- Programação,
- Bancos de dados,
- LINQ
A IBM disponibilizou a versão de produção do Data Server Provider for .NET incluindo suporte para Entity Framework da Microsoft permitindo que seus usuários criem esquemas EDM e executem declarações EntitySQL e LINQ.
- Tópicos
- ADO.NET Entity Framework,
- ADO.NET,
- .NET,
- Acesso a Dados,
- Programação,
- Bancos de dados
O Entity Framework não dá suporte à modelos de dados com mais de 50 a 100 entities. Mas considerando que as empresas normalmente executam tudo em um banco de dados central, centenas de tabelas são a norma. O time ADO.NET da Microsoft está apresentando um artigo sobre como "Trabalhar com Grandes Modelos no Entity Framework", uma lista de problemas e 'gambiarras' para usuários EF.
- Tópicos
- ADO.NET Entity Framework,
- ADO.NET,
- .NET,
- Acesso a Dados,
- Programação,
- Bancos de dados
Em um post recente no seu blog, Stu Smith alegou que “LINQ-to-Entities vai retornar resultados diferentes dependendo de que queries anteriores você tenha executado!”. Se verdadeiro, isso tornaria usando o Framework Entity muito mais difícil de usar do que o necessário. Nós conversamos com Elisa Flasko do time do ADO.NET para descobrir o que realmente está acontecendo.
- Tópicos
- ADO.NET Entity Framework,
- ADO.NET,
- IDE,
- .NET,
- Programação,
- ORM
Os designers tanto no LINQ to SQL quanto no Framework de Entidade ADO.NET tem um número de limitações. A fim de contornar essas limitações, produtos como a ferramenta DBML/EDMX foram desenvolvidos.
- Tópicos
- ADO.NET Entity Framework,
- ADO.NET,
- .NET,
- Acesso a Dados,
- ORM,
- Bancos de dados,
- Programação
Uma das maiores queixas sobre o ADO.NET Framework Entity e o LINQ to SQL, foi de que ele não suporta o monitoramento de mudanças. Apesar de tudo desde o ADO.NET DataSets até cada um dos ORMs não Microsoft que suportam isso de forma nativa, a Microsoft não apresenta intenção de corrigir isso no .NET 4.0/VS 2010.
- Tópicos
- ADO.NET Entity Framework,
- ADO.NET,
- .NET,
- Acesso a Dados,
- Programação,
- LINQ,
- Bancos de dados
Em Julho nós reportamos que o LINQ to SQL foi transferido para a equipe SQL Data Programmability. Este evento ampliou em muito a preocupação da comunidade de desenvolvedores, que teme que o trabalho no LINQ to SQL possa ser interrompido em favor do Entity Framework ADO.NET. Um anúncio recente de Tim Mallalieu, gerente de Produto de ambos LINQ to SQL e Entity Framework, exacerbou esta preocupação.